What Are Collagen Peptides?
They are short chains of amino acids extracted from animal collagen, usually harnessed from bovine, marine, or porcine connective tissue. Collagen is broken into hydrolyzed collagen peptides through a process of hydrolysis, making it easily absorbable. After ingestion and metabolization, these peptides help to keep the structure and function of your skin, joints, and bones intact. Hydrolyzed collagen peptides are preferred for supplementation because they are bioavailable and can be absorbed quickly, making them effective.

Types of Collagen Peptides
There are many types of collagen, but most supplements incorporate Types I, II, and III. Collagen peptides for skin health, bone health, and beauty are types I and III, and Type II is for joint and cartilage support. A lot of hydrolyzed collagen peptide supplements on the market combine Type I and Type III for well-rounded benefits. By knowing what type you are consuming, you can correlate the supplement with your own health goals.
How to Use Collagen Peptides
Collagen peptides are taken daily in 5 – 15 grams for maximum results. Mix them with food or blend them with smoothies, for instance, or stir them into coffee. Look for hydrolyzed collagen peptides, for they are absorbed faster. Vitamin C works best when paired with collagen peptide as it aids in collagen production. Consistent use helps support healthier skin, improve mobility, and boost overall function in the long term. This is an easy and low-effort addition that will add to your wellness routine.
